Web10 de nov. de 2024 · ABC Company has gross fixed assets of $5,000,000 and accumulated depreciation of $2,000,000. Sales over the last 12 months totaled $9,000,000. The calculation of ABC's fixed asset turnover ratio is: $9,000,000 Net sales ÷ ($5,000,000 Gross fixed assets - $2,000,000 Accumulated depreciation) = 3.0 Turnover per year. WebCommonly a high asset turnover is accompanied with a low return on sales and vice versa. Retailers generally have high asset turnovers accompanied by low margins.
